Things to Consider When Choosing a Gym

Finding the right gym for you can be a personal choice, depending on various factors. Here are some considerations to keep in mind when selecting a gym in Beecroft:

  • Location - Choose a gym that is conveniently located, making it easier for you to fit workouts into your daily routine.

  • Facilities and Equipment - Ensure that the gym has the equipment and facilities you need for your workout preferences, such as cardio machines, free weights, and group fitness rooms.

  • Trainers and Staff - Look for gyms with knowledgeable and certified trainers who can guide and support you throughout your fitness journey.

  • Membership Options - Consider the flexibility of membership options, such as monthly or yearly packages, to match your budget and commitment level.

  • Hygiene and Safety - Inquire about the gym's cleanliness protocols, especially in light of recent health concerns. Ensure that the gym maintains a safe and sanitized environment.

Benefits of Joining a Gym in Beecroft

Beyond the physical benefits, joining a gym in Beecroft offers numerous advantages:

  • Variety of Fitness Programs - Gyms in Beecroft typically offer a wide range of fitness programs, including yoga, Zumba, cycling, and more. This variety allows you to explore different exercises and find what suits you best.

  • Motivation and Accountability - The supportive environment of a gym can keep you motivated to achieve your fitness goals. Working out alongside like-minded individuals can provide the encouragement and accountability needed to stay on track.

  • Access to Professional Guidance - Many gyms in Beecroft have qualified trainers who can offer guidance, personalized workouts, and nutritional advice to help you optimize your fitness routine.

  • Community and Social Connections - Joining a gym can expose you to a community of individuals with similar interests. Building connections and friendships with fellow gym-goers can make your fitness journey more enjoyable.
